File a complaint - harassment or discrimination

If you think you’ve experienced harassment or discrimination, you can contact the Human Rights Office (HRO) to discuss your options, including filing a complaint. 

Harassing and discriminatory behaviors are against the law. The University addresses concerns about harassment and discrimination with University Policy 67a and the procedures listed below:

Complaint process - Responsable conduct

This Policy is a preventive tool that focuses on a proactive approach to informal resolution when a breach of responsible conduct occurs.

Confidentiality and follow-up

We guarantee the confidentiality of all messages we receive. Please be sure to provide your full contact information so that we can contact you and let you know how we will proceed. We do not respond to anonymous communications.

Processing time

We will send you an acknowledgement within five working days of receiving your feedback. If applicable, we will also follow up with you. If you filed a complaint, we will advise you of the estimated time it will take to handle your complaint, which can vary depending on the complexity of the situation.
